What is potato harvesters?

This is an agricultural machine designed for harvesting potatoes. Some models may have additional devices that allow you to pick onions and beets from the roll.

Potato harvesters are designed in such a way as to obtain the maximum yield of products with minimal damage to the soil and adjacent areas with a different crop. These machines have high maneuverability and can easily turn around even in difficult conditions and in small areas.

All modern models of combines have a side type of digging. This means that the tractor moves away from the ridge, and not behind or in front of it. This allows the use of large tires for the wheels and, as a consequence, reduce pressure on the soil.

The working principle of a potato harvester

The combine is equipped with a special digging device, which consists of two knives with adjustable angle of inclination, a roller for adjusting the depth of immersion, spring-loaded cut-off discs and rollers for removing the tops. During operation, this device digs from a certain depth the soil layer with tubers and tops and feeds it to the screening mechanism. Then the tubers, along with the tops and the unsealed remains of the soil, are fed to the feeding belt. Around this mechanism is a tape to remove the leaves with large cells and 5-6 rows of ridges to remove leaves, soil and stones.

After all these stages, the potatoes are routed with a rotating rubber "fingers" and a retaining roller to a sorting panel and tape to remove small potatoes and waste. The screening panel is in a horizontal position. It is well protected from dust and provided with comfortable conditions for workers. Work can be from 5 to 7 people from two sides.

After sorting, the potatoes are routed through the tapes for discharge into a special hopper with a movable bottom. Adjusting the height of the bottom, you can reduce the height of the fall of tubers, and therefore reduce their damage. Also, the bunker makes it possible to unload products from two sides. For tubers of small sizes potato harvesters have a small hopper with the possibility of unloading.

Types of potato harvesters

All potato harvesters are subdivided according to the following parameters:

  1. By the size of the field being treated: combines for large, large and medium, medium and small areas.
  2. According to the capacity of the bunker: machines with a two-ton, three-ton bunker, etc.
  3. By design: elevator and bunker.
  4. By the method of attachment: trailed, semi-mounted, hinged.
  5. By the number of simultaneously processed rows: single-row, double-row, four-row harvesters.
  6. According to the method of soil undermining: combines of central and lateral subsoil.

The most popular in Russia is a single-row potato harvester. Such a machine is ideal for the processing of small areas, as the volume of its bunker in different models is up to 10 tons. If the harvest is large, it is much more effective to use an elevator type harvester. Much less often used four-row machine. Basically, this type of combine is used in potato farms.

In addition to technical characteristics, most farmers pay attention to the performance of the combine. In most cases, in agriculture, side-digging combines are used, which significantly less damage the tubers. The matter is that at such machine the unit is on the side of the tractor, which travels along the already cleaned territory. Also this type of combine is distinguished by the highest quality of potato processing and greater productivity.

The basic firms-manufacturers

The modern market of agricultural machinery is represented by a large number of machines of different modifications. In our time among the Russian agrarians the most popular is the potato harvester Grimme and harvester of the Dutch-Russian company "Kolnag". Until recently, Russia also produced potato harvesters at Agrotechresurs. But now the enterprise produces only the model KPK-2-01 and a number of spare parts for previously manufactured combine types.

The best reputation in the market of agricultural machinery was earned by the potato harvester Grimme. He has proven himself in the industrial cultivation of potatoes. In addition, the manufacturer produces machines of different types: bunker, elevator, self-propelled combines, with side and central digging. A wide range of potato harvesting units allows you to choose a machine for any type of soil. Important advantages of Grimme combines are the high quality of the work performed and excellent operational parameters.

Domestic harvesters

Many agrarians prefer potato harvesters of Russian origin. Although foreign aggregates have better functional characteristics and greater comfort for the operator, they are less prepared to work with Russian soil. Among domestic models the most commonly used is the PDA machine. Potato harvester of this type is produced by the enterprise "Riazelmash" since 1987. At first the plant produced a three-row aggregate. And after a while it was possible to start production of a two-row combine, which is produced to this day.

Cost of potato harvesting unit

There are many factors that determine how much the potato harvester will eventually cost. The price for this unit for today ranges from 850 thousand to 20 million rubles. The most affordable domestic harvesters. And for European multifunctional potato harvesters have to pay a little more. Among the trailer type harvesters, the most expensive segment of the market is represented by Grimme units.

Basically, the cost of the combine is influenced by the level of productivity, dimensions, type of equipment (self-propelled or trailed machine), type of subsoil, number of harvested rows, tuber cleaning quality and other parameters. If the combine is planned to be used in large areas, then it is better to choose a more powerful machine with a large bunker. And for the processing of small areas, the best option is a mini potato harvester, the average cost of which is 850 thousand rubles.
